Senior Web Content Specialist
- Dana-Farber Cancer Institute (Boston, MA)
-
The Senior Web Content Specialist is responsible for managing and optimizing website content for Dana-Farber’s main external website – dana-farber.org – and select affiliated sites. This role ensures accuracy, consistency, and quality across Dana-Farber’s websites, working cross-functionally with throughout the Communications & Marketing department and Enterprise Web Solutions and Digital Platforms teams to deliver high-quality web experiences. The position requires expertise in content management systems (Drupal), SEO, web analytics, accessibility standards (WCAG), and user experience (UX) principles to enhance website functionality and engagement. With a strong background in large-scale web content management and project coordination, the Senior Web Content Specialist plays a key role in delivering a cohesive and effective digital experience.

This position's work location is fully remote with occasional time on-campus in Boston, MA. The selected candidate may only work remotely from a New England state (ME, VT, NH, MA, CT, RI).
+ Write, edit, and manage website content using the Drupal Content Management System (CMS).
+ Format, publish, and update multimedia content (images, video, graphics) for optimal web performance.
+ Ensure accuracy, consistency, and quality in daily website updates.
+ Work with Web Content Manager and internal stakeholders to develop new content and features.
+ Serve as the primary point of contact for assigned internal clients or departments regarding web content needs.
+ Translate client goals into actionable web strategies that align with best practices.
+ Provide training and guidance to content contributors on web standards, CMS use, and editorial quality.
+ Manage timelines, expectations, and deliverables for multiple projects simultaneously.
+ Partner with Communications & Marketing department and Enterprise Web Solutions and Digital Platforms teams to ensure a cohesive digital experience.
+ Support web testing and quality assurance processes, including link checks, functionality testing, and accessibility validation.
+ Use web analytics and SEO strategies to track performance and optimize content for search engine visibility and conversion.
+ Apply user experience (UX) and WCAG accessibility principles to enhance website navigation, user journeys, and engagement.
+ Monitor industry trends and recommend improvements for website features, navigation, and search functionality.
Education required: Bachelor's Degree
Education preferred: Master's Degree
Area of study: Communications, Marketing, Web Design or a related field.
Experience required: 5 years of experience in web content management, digital marketing, or related role, with a proven track record of producing and managing high-quality web content for large websites.
Experience preferred: Experience in healthcare or similarly complex fields is preferred.
Knowledge, Skills, Abilities:
+ Proficiency in managing large-scale websites, including creating, editing, and optimizing content for performance and user engagement. Expertise in SEO strategies and web analytics ensures content is discoverable and effective. Strong attention to detail is required to maintain accuracy, consistency, and quality in all published materials.
+ Advanced knowledge of CMS platforms, particularly Drupal, is essential for efficiently managing and publishing web content. This includes the ability to troubleshoot issues, implement new features, and train others on CMS usage.
+ Strong understanding of WCAG standards to ensure websites are accessible to all users, including those with disabilities. Knowledge of cross-browser, cross-platform, and cross-device compatibility ensures a seamless user experience across diverse environments.
+ Proven ability to work with cross-functional teams, including developers, designers, UX specialists, and writers, to deliver cohesive web experiences.
+ Strong communication skills are critical for managing client relationships, translating goals into actionable strategies, and maintaining alignment with stakeholders.
+ Strong writing and editing skills, with the ability to create clear, engaging, and plain-language content tailored to diverse audiences.
+ Familiarity with tools like Jira or Asana to manage multiple projects, timelines, and deliverables effectively.
+ Strong prioritization and organizational skills are necessary to me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
+ Strong attention to detail is required to maintain accuracy, consistency, and quality in all published materials in a fast-paced environment.
+ Understanding of UX principles and information architecture to optimize website navigation, user journeys, and overall engagement. This includes the ability to analyze user behavior and recommend improvements to enhance functionality and usability.
